Gianni Berengo Gardin – Italiens Schwarzweiß-Chronist: Gesellschaft, Haltung & fotografisches Vermächtnis - EP#052
In dieser Episode widmen wir uns dem Leben und Werk von Gianni Berengo Gardin, einem der bedeutendsten Fotografen Italiens, der am 7. August 2025 im Alter von 94 Jahren verstorben ist. Berengo Gardin verstand sich nie als Künstler, sondern als Handwerker mit Haltung. Seine Schwarzweißfotografie ist nicht Stilmittel, sondern Ausdruck einer tiefen Überzeugung: Fotografie als gesellschaftliche Verantwortung.Wir tauchen ein in seine Biografie, seine Philosophie, seine Schlüsselwerke und seine Rolle als Chronist Italiens. Die Affäre Lauber, Folge 1: Lauber fliegt auf
In der Affäre um Bundesanwalt Michael Lauber drehte sich scheinbar alles um die geheimen Treffen mit Fifa-Boss Gianni Infantino. In Wirklichkeit ging es aber um viel mehr. In den Kommissionszimmern des Bundeshauses spielte sich ein Krimi ab, der die Schweiz an den Rand einer Staatskrise führte. SRF-Bundeshausredaktor Oliver Washington hat sich durch Dokumente gearbeitet und mit wichtigen Beteiligten nochmals gesprochen. Zusammen mit Eliane Leiser präsentiert er in dieser dreiteiligen Serie die Lauber-Saga in einer ganz neuen Dimension. Folge 1 knüpft bei Laubers Treffen mit Infantino an.
